Cargo Pants + Fitted Top + Sneakers
This look just screams "cool girl” to me. I’ll be layering up with a bomber or varsity jacket.
Miniskirt + Sweater + Leg Warmers
The return of leg warmers is one of my favorite micro-trends for fall—especially when styled with uggs and a miniskirt like Sophia did above.
Turtleneck + Trousers + Belt
This look is a classic, chic look for fall or winter. This is definitely one of my go-to wear-to-work looks.
Maxi Skirt + Strapless Top
I am all about a great maxi skirt these days, especially styled with a strapless top. I can’t wait to wear this look on a weekend out.
Miniskirt + Heeled Loafers + Ankle Socks
I just got a pair of heeled loafers and was trying to figure out how to style them, and then I saw this super-chic picture of Jen styling them with a miniskirt and white little socks. Obsessed.
